About the Job
Job Description

The Director of Athletics Advancement provides strategic leadership for athletics-related partnership development, external engagement, and athletics philanthropy initiatives. This leadership role is responsible for cultivating and managing high-value corporate, alumni, family, and community relationships that generate sponsorship revenue, philanthropic support, and long-term institutional engagement opportunities.

Working collaboratively with the Director of Athletics, Associate Vice President of Institutional Advancement, and others, the Director oversees athletics engagement initiatives, supervises the Athletics Advancement Coordinator, and leads efforts to reach specific athletics fundraising and college-wide sponsorship and fundraising goals.

Primary Responsibilities

· Develop and execute comprehensive athletics partnerships and engagement strategy

· Supervise the Athletics Advancement Coordinator

· Cultivate and steward high-level corporate partnerships and sponsorship agreements.

· Manage a portfolio of athletics-related donors, prospects, alumni, families, and corporate partners.

· Personally solicit sponsorship and philanthropic commitments.

· Collaborate with Advancement leadership on campaign initiatives and donor pipeline development.
